I want to change my routine, help?

Hello.

I have been working out for 3 months now and I want to change my workout routine. Mainly because im a little bored with it and I just want to try something new. My workouts are a little too long also.

My current routine is:
Sunday: Back, Shoulders, Chest, Cardio (20 min HIIT on bike)
Monday: Biceps, Triceps, Forearms, Legs, Cardio (HIIT)
Tuesday: OFF
Wednesday: (same as Sunday)
Thursday: (same as Monday)
Friday: OFF
Sat: OFF

I do 3 excercises and 4 sets for each body part, except legs. For legs, I do one set per body part. With this routine, each body part is being worked 2x a week.

My stats:
19 yrs old.
172 lbs.
5'10-5'11 in height.
Body fat (not sure, not much tho. I need to lose probably 5-10 lbs of fat) Im going to get this measured next week.

I just started my diet which mainly consists of 5 meals a day with alot of protein. I take a multi-vitamin daily and drink whey shakes.

My goals:
I want to be lean & cut with my abs showing by the time summer arrives while at the same time gaining some size. But at this point, my abs are my number one priority. Im already pretty skinny, so gaining some muscle mass would be wonderful.

I was looking into hypertrophy-specific-training and I am a little interested. Are there any other forms of this that would work for me?

What other kinds of routines can you recommend for me and my goals? How is this working for you?

Any help is greatly appreciated.
Thanks

TITANS 1854 HAS A GOOD IDEA,YOU SHOULD NEVER DO TRICEPS ,CHEST AND SHOULDERS BACK TO BACK EVER.TOO MUCH TRICEP WORK NO RECOVERY DAY.I NEVER WORK A PUSH OR PULL DAY BACK TO BACK.I WOULD ALSO HAVE 6 MEALS INSTEAD OF 5.YOU NEED FOOD EVERY 2.5 HOURS.WORK HEAVY 6 TO 8 REPS WITH 3 WORK SETS,9 SETS TOTAL LARGE BODYPARTS,6 TO 7 SMALL.STICK TO BASIC EXERCISES,STAY AWAY FROM ISOLATION EXERCISES.DO HIT 3 TIMES PER WEEK.CHECK WAIST AT NAVEL,IF NO REDUCTION ELIMINATE CARBS LAST MEAL.NEXT WEEK CUT CARBS FROM LAST 2 MEALS,WHEN YOU DO THAT ON EVERY 4TH DAY YOU GO BACK TO EATING CARBS WITH EVERY MEAL.-MR. CLEAN
